PH Ambassador to South Africa Presents Credentials to King of Lesotho, Meets with High Gov’t Officials

PRETORIA 09 December 2019 –– Philippine Ambassador to South Africa Joseph Gerard B. Angeles presented his credentials to King Letsie III of the Kingdom of Lesotho on 28 November 2019 at the Lesotho’s Royal Palace in Maseru.

The meeting between King Letsie III and Ambassador Angeles was very cordial.  Ambassador Angeles conveyed to King Letsie III the greetings of President Duterte and thanked him for the hospitality and opportunity that have been extended to the Filipino community in Lesotho, who contribute to the economic growth of the country. Ambassador Angeles likewise expressed the Philippine’s desire to further strengthen the bilateral ties between the two countries, especially in the context of South-South cooperation.

King Letsie III on his part welcomed the Philippine delegation, and mirrored his satisfaction on the friendly relations between the Philippines and Lesotho.The king mentioned that he knew Filipinos in Lesotho to be kind, efficient and hardworking, and said that they contributed positively to Lesotho’s economy and well-being. He also stated that he was aware of the impressive economic performance of the Philippines, particularly under the leadership of President Duterte, and he looked forward to learn lessons from the Philippines that might help Lesotho in its own path towards economic development.

Ambassador Angeles also had a meeting with Minister of Trade Halebonoe J. Setsabi, who is concurrently the acting Minister of Foreign Affairs. The discussions were fruitful, especially on sharing of the best practices and South-South cooperation, including in the fields of agriculture, health, Micro-Small-Medium Enterprise manufacturing, sports and culture, and Human Resource development and training. Both parties likewise discussed enhanced mutual cooperation and support in international forums such as the United Nations, Non-Aligned Movement and G77.

A meeting between Prime Minister Dr. Tom Thabane and Ambassador Angeles was also held. Prime Minister Thabane reached deep into Lesotho’s past and thanked the Philippines for its steadfast opposition to the apartheid. Matters of mutual interest were likewise discussed. END
